The last top wrestler DJ fought was Broseph, and while he KO'd him last time, their 1st fight was competitive. Cejudo's naturally a better wrestler than Bena, but Bena has more punching power and is a more skilled inside boxer. The best wrestler DJ faced before that was McCall, who had good success in spots. Those fights tell me Cejudo has a solid chance here. DJ will likely stuff/avoid shots because of his footwork, but if and when Cejudo gets top control he's more skilled on top than anyone else at FLW. Should be interesting if that happens.
